noun
- The quality or state of being butch; masculine appearance, behavior, or presentation, especially in women or in LGBTQ+ contexts.
Usage: informal; often used in LGBTQ+ communities
Examples
- She embraced her butchness by wearing tailored suits and short hair.
- The butchness of her style made her feel more confident and authentic.
- In the LGBTQ+ community, butchness is celebrated as a valid form of gender expression.
- Her butchness contrasted sharply with her sister's more feminine aesthetic.
- The character's butchness was central to her identity in the film.
